Subway

Store Details

  • Address

    3784 W 117th St
    Cleveland, OH 44111

    Phone Number

    (216) 941-7827
    Tell people what you think

More Business Info & Hours

More Nearby Business

  • Subway 10614 Lorain Ave, Cleveland, OH
  • Subway 6641 Pearl Rd, Cleveland, OH
  • Subway 7792 W 130th St, Cleveland, OH
  • Subway 6551 Broadway Ave, Cleveland, OH
  • Subway 7525 Granger Rd, Cleveland, OH
  • Subway 3362 Warren Rd, Cleveland, OH
  • Subway 15317 Detroit Ave, Lakewood, OH
  • Subway 7214 Pearl Rd, Cleveland, OH
  • Subway 1417 E 9th St, Cleveland, OH
  • Subway 1701 Superior Ave E, Cleveland, OH